Introducing Cluj-Napoca


Cluj-Napoca is the unofficial capital of the region of Transylvania, and is home to mysterious stories, medieval and baroque architecture, magnificent structures, and excitement to discover. The city is Romania’s second biggest with a population of nearly 325,000 and is in the northwest of the country, around the same distance away from Bucharest, Belgrade, and Budapest. In addition to its cafes filled with students, the city has many activities to enjoy, including the annual Transylvania International Film Festival, the Jazz in the Park festival, and the Untold Festival.

Cluj-Napoca International Airport is about 10 km from the city center. It takes about 30 minutes on the number 8 bus or number 5 trolleybus to make the trip.

A taxi from the airport to the city center takes about 15 minutes and costs RON 45 on average.
